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
042424599 71606379368 30
210949219 94453
210949219 94453
868372269 253 129
All about undefined
Interested in learning more?
210949219 94453
868372269 253 129
See more
21 0966
28132363662 19878 7653049 52414
See more
1426 82 85011
1397321747 901 1625
See more